What? You can have the high beams on manually any time you want. 1. Ensure your headlight stalk is in the "ON"/headlight position 2. Ensure your headlight stalk is pushed away from you towards the dash 3. Ensure that "Auto High Beam" is not enabled (check the AHB button on the left side of the dash).

Apparently this isn't on the Plus trim. I looked, and my light level stick doesn't have an AUTO setting (has lights, DRL, etc but not AUTO click setting like shown in the manual page you posted). In fact, one strange thing (coming from a Honda where the DRLs are always on) -- on the Prime, you have to move the position switch to DRL if you want DRL, otherwise the DRLs are always off. I generally prefer the DRLs to be on, which makes it weird after using the "regular" lights, when I'm finished, I can't just turn the settling lever all the way back until it stops (that would be OFF -- in which case the DRLs won't come on next time) but rather just one click back to DRL. Have to get used to that. But as far as the auto lights... seems to be a Premium/Advanced thing, not a Plus thing. I have the Advanced. It has positions for OFF and AUTO next to one another. I leave it in AUTO, so when car is running in daylight, Daytime (total of 4 headlights) are on. When it's dark, eight headlights turn on. With the Highbeam Auto feature turned on, when several conditions are met, Hi beams come on automatically and are dimmed as appropriate! It rocks! .
